Through Executive Develop-ment Associates (EDAs)' high-potential work and research, we have noted a significant gap between the number of prepared leaders needed and the number of people who will be capable of filling the need. The good news is that leading organizations are gearing up for the challenge with new and innovative ways of developing leaders through career and leadership development strategies, systems and programs.

 
 
 

As today's workplace evolves, companies are forced to make changes within the organization in order to keep up with trends in the workplace. In a recent study, The Boston Consulting Group (BCG), partnering with the Society for Human Resource Management (SHRM), identified eight new trends in the workplace and how companies should approach these changes.
